Lary’s Photography

Lary Crews has been taking photographs ever since his days as a U.S. Navy photojournalist manning a Koni-Omega Rapid during the Vietnam War.

He worked his way through college as a photographer at Honeymoon Haven in the Pocono Mountains and his pictures were published in Popular Photography three times.
